The Connection Between Oral Health and Heart Disease

As a health-conscious individual, you may already prioritize your dental health, but have you considered its connection to your heart? Recent studies have highlighted a significant link between oral health and heart disease, suggesting that maintaining your dental hygiene could play a crucial role in protecting your cardiovascular health. 

Your mouth is a gateway to your body, and the state of your oral health can reflect and affect your overall well-being. Researchers have found that poor oral hygiene can lead to an increase in bacteria in the mouth, which may enter the bloodstream and cause inflammation—a key factor in the development of heart disease. This connection underscores the importance of regular dental check-ups and maintaining good oral hygiene practices.

How Oral Health Impacts Cardiovascular Health

Inflammation plays a central role in the link between oral health and heart disease. When you neglect dental care, plaque—a sticky film of bacteria—can build up on your teeth. If not removed, this plaque can lead to gum disease, also known as periodontal disease. The bacteria from periodontal disease can enter your bloodstream, causing inflammation in your blood vessels and increasing your risk of heart disease.

Moreover, inflammation caused by gum disease can trigger a chain reaction in your body. This inflammation can lead to the narrowing of arteries, a condition known as atherosclerosis, which restricts blood flow and increases the risk of heart attacks and strokes. By maintaining good oral hygiene, you can reduce the risk of these inflammatory processes and protect your heart.

Understanding the Risk Factors and Taking Preventative Measures

While maintaining good oral hygiene is a critical step, it's also important to be aware of other risk factors that can contribute to both gum disease and heart disease. Smoking, for instance, is a significant risk factor for both conditions. Quitting smoking can dramatically improve your oral health and reduce your risk of heart disease.

Additionally, conditions such as diabetes can increase your susceptibility to gum disease, which in turn can exacerbate heart disease. If you have diabetes, managing your blood sugar levels is vital for preventing complications in both your oral and cardiovascular health. By working closely with your healthcare providers, you can develop a comprehensive plan that addresses all aspects of your health.

Addressing Common Oral Health Concerns

Understanding and addressing common oral health concerns can help you take proactive steps to protect your overall health. Issues such as bad breath, sensitive teeth, and bleeding gums can be indicative of underlying problems that require professional attention. If you experience any of these symptoms, it's crucial to consult with your dentist promptly to prevent further complications.

For instance, bleeding gums may be a sign of gingivitis, an early stage of gum disease that can progress to more severe conditions if left untreated. Your dentist can provide guidance on proper brushing and flossing techniques, as well as recommend treatments to restore your gum health. By addressing these concerns early, you can prevent them from affecting your cardiovascular health.
